I managed to get a really good lip kit at a great price...... Shat my second pair when I got the shipping quote......:confused0068::barf:
Rule of thumb for importing bigger parts, what ever you purchase, double it on shipping costs.
Eg Modelista full aero kit $1200, shipping to SA $1600 excl duties.....

Most TRD parts are available, take the part number to your dealership, you will be required to pay upfront or a deposit, which Toyota will bring in if not in stock in JHB... These parts are expensive and based on the numbers coming in and the potential people that will buy the add ons, possibly does not make sense to stock in South Africa.
Can't say Toyota are no good due to this....

I agree the prices are way up there but as I work for a freight company I can say there are many factors why the parts are as expensive as they are. Customs duties, VAT, shipping charges. Toyota SA just needs to come out with a catalogue of all the parts available in Japan and make them available for special order.

The list of accessories on their local website is too short in my opinion. And also if they are to bring such special items in, the consumer must understand that because it is a special order item that it will cost more and take longer to arrive.
